Goddy Jedy Agba OFR, born Godwin,[1] 20 August 1958, is a Nigerian bureaucrat, politician, farmer, author and former Group general manager, Crude Oil Marketing Division, Nigerian National Petroleum Company (NNPC).[2] As of July 2019, he was nominated as a minister of the federal republic of Nigeria from Cross River by the government of President Muhammadu Buhari. In 1983, he had his first Degree in International Studies from Ahmadu Bello University, Zaria. He obtained his master's degree in International Law and Diplomacy from the University of Lagos, Akoka in 1989. Goddy joined Federal Civil Service in 1984 and retired at NNPC in 2014 to join the Nigerian politics.[3]
